First things first, placement and preparation are key. Think of your monitor as a silent observer. You'll want to place it in a spot that truly represents the air you're interested in – perhaps in your living room where you spend evenings, your office where you work, or even an outdoor area you frequent. However, just like a careful scientist, you need to avoid anything that could give you a skewed picture. Keep it away from direct pollution sources like the exhaust fan above your stove, the draft from an open window, or even a heating vent. These could give you a sudden spike that isn't representative of the general air quality.

For outdoor readings, be mindful of the elements. A sudden downpour or direct blazing sun could interfere with the monitor's delicate sensors. Also, if your monitor is brand new or hasn't been used in a while, give it a little time to wake up and get its bearings. Placing it in a cool, ventilated space for about 30 minutes or so allows it to calibrate and ensure it's giving you the most accurate initial readings.

Next up is power and connectivity. Just like any electronic device, your air quality monitor needs a reliable source of energy. Whether it plugs into a wall socket with a USB cable or runs on a rechargeable battery, make sure it's consistently powered. Many modern monitors also boast the convenience of WiFi connectivity. This allows them to talk to your smartphone app or upload data to a cloud platform. So, ensure it's within range of a stable WiFi signal if it has this feature. Some sophisticated monitors might even need specific calibration, especially for detecting tricky pollutants like formaldehyde or volatile organic compounds (VOCs). Check the manual to see if yours requires this step.

Now for the exciting part: reading and interpretation. Your monitor will likely display various numbers and perhaps even a color-coded scale. These represent different aspects of the air quality, such as the concentration of fine particulate matter (PM2.5), larger particles (PM10), carbon dioxide (CO2), or those aforementioned VOCs. Often, these raw numbers are translated into an Air Quality Index (AQI), which simplifies things into categories like "Good," "Moderate," or "Unhealthy." It's a good idea to familiarize yourself with these AQI levels and what they mean for your health. Many monitors come with a companion mobile app or a web dashboard, as IQAir mentions. These can be incredibly helpful for viewing your air quality data in real-time, tracking trends over time, and even receiving alerts if the air quality dips below a certain level.

Finally, to keep your air quality detective working accurately, a little maintenance and calibration goes a long way. Dust and debris can accumulate on the sensors and interfere with their readings. Gently wiping them with a soft, dry cloth regularly will help maintain their accuracy. As the Morton Grove Public Library points out, some monitors might need periodic calibration to ensure they remain spot-on. And keep an eye out for any alerts your monitor might give you, as these could indicate a spike in pollutants that you need to be aware of.
